Al-Jazeera English launches
For those of us unhappy with the job that CNN and BBC do of covering world news, there's now another alternative; Al-Jazeera English. Assuming, of course, that you're lucky enough to receive it; as the New York Times reported in their cheekily-titled story "Not coming soon to a channel near you":
Secretary of Defense Donald H. Rumsfeld once famously denounced the Arab-language Al Jazeera as “vicious, inaccurate and inexcusable,†which may be one reason that major cable and satellite providers in the United States declined to offer the English version. Yesterday, most Americans could watch it only on the Internet
According to their web site, their opening broadcast was available to be watched in 80 million households around the world, apparently the highest number of any international news channel. Of course, what that really means is that no international news channel has launched in years and been able to take advantage of the numbers offered by satellite broadcast.
The most interesting thing about Al Jazeera, of course, is its audience. In the "should Iran be able to have nuclear weapons" poll on their website, 40% answered "yes" when I checked the results. For my part, I will be happy to see a news program which refers to the West Bank as an "occupied" rather than a "disputed" territory.
